What Makes the Best LED Display for XR?
Extended Reality (XR) has transformed virtual production, allowing filmmakers, broadcasters and content creators to blend physical and digital worlds in real time. However, not all LED displays are suitable for XR environments.
Unlike traditional digital signage, XR applications place exceptional demands on display performance. Every pixel must work flawlessly on camera as well as to the human eye.
Pixel pitch is often the first consideration. Fine pixel pitch displays minimize visible pixel structure and reduce moiré artefacts, enabling cameras to operate closer to the LED volume while maintaining realism.
Refresh rate and frame rate are equally important. High-performance displays help ensure smooth motion reproduction, support slow-motion cinematography and reduce visual artefacts during filming. As productions become increasingly complex, displays capable of supporting multiple camera angles and perspectives simultaneously provide additional flexibility.
Brightness and contrast also play a critical role. Modern productions frequently combine bright highlights with darker scenes, requiring displays capable of maintaining high dynamic range without sacrificing color accuracy.
Reliability and thermal performance should not be overlooked. Large XR volumes operate for extended periods, often in enclosed studio environments. Displays that run cooler reduce operating costs while creating a more comfortable environment for performers and crew.
The most advanced XR displays also support floor applications, enabling truly immersive environments that seamlessly blend walls and floors into a single visual canvas. This opens up new creative possibilities and reduces the need for physical set construction.
Ultimately, the best LED display for XR is not simply the one with the smallest pixel pitch. It is the display that combines image quality, color performance, frame rate, efficiency and durability to create believable virtual environments that perform consistently in front of the camera.
